We will get the startup time and garbage collections during the process:
;; The default is 800 kilobytes. Measured in bytes.
(setq gc-cons-threshold (* 50 1000 1000))
;; Profile emacs startup
(add-hook 'emacs-startup-hook
(lambda ()
(message "*** Emacs loaded in %s with %d garbage collections."
(format "%.2f seconds"
(float-time
(time-subtract after-init-time before-init-time)))
gcs-done)))
Some global settings that make sense for me. Silence the warnings from native comp that are really annoying and save space and badwith cloning only what we need.
;;silence native-comp warnings
(setq native-comp-async-report-warnings-errors nil)
;;use shallow clones
(setq straight-vc-git-default-clone-depth 1)
;;no startup message
(setq inhibit-startup-message t)
;; if you want line numbers
;; (global-display-line-numbers-mode 1)
(add-hook 'prog-mode-hook 'display-line-numbers-mode)
;; popular bindings
;;(global-set-key "\C-x\C-m" 'execute-extended-command) ;; add binding for M-x
;;(global-set-key "\C-c\C-m" 'execute-extended-command) ;; add binding for M-x
;;see the changes on disk
(global-auto-revert-mode t)
;;follow symlinks to files
(setq vc-follow-symlinks t)
;;save where you were working
(desktop-save-mode 1)
;;make dired show this in a nice way
(setq dired-listing-switches "-alh")
;; use utf-8
(set-default-coding-systems 'utf-8)
;;use ssh for tramp
(setq tramp-default-method "ssh")
;; Set default font
(set-face-attribute 'default nil
:family "Source Code Pro"
:height 140
:weight 'normal
:width 'normal)
This following part taken from the package better defaults but if you will not use ido
;;remove menu-bar and scroll bars
(unless (eq window-system 'ns)
(menu-bar-mode -1))
(when (fboundp 'tool-bar-mode)
(tool-bar-mode -1))
(when (fboundp 'scroll-bar-mode)
(scroll-bar-mode -1))
(when (fboundp 'horizontal-scroll-bar-mode)
(horizontal-scroll-bar-mode -1))
(autoload 'zap-up-to-char "misc"
"Kill up to, but not including ARGth occurrence of CHAR." t)
(require 'uniquify)
(setq uniquify-buffer-name-style 'forward)
;; remember where you were visiting buffers
;; https://www.emacswiki.org/emacs/SavePlace
(save-place-mode 1)
;; some better built-in alternatives
(global-set-key (kbd "M-/") 'hippie-expand)
(global-set-key (kbd "C-x C-b") 'ibuffer)
(global-set-key (kbd "M-z") 'zap-up-to-char)
(global-set-key (kbd "C-s") 'isearch-forward-regexp)
(global-set-key (kbd "C-r") 'isearch-backward-regexp)
(global-set-key (kbd "C-M-s") 'isearch-forward)
(global-set-key (kbd "C-M-r") 'isearch-backward)
;;show matching parenthesis
(show-paren-mode 1)
;;use spaces, not tabs
(setq-default indent-tabs-mode nil)
(setq save-interprogram-paste-before-kill t
apropos-do-all t
mouse-yank-at-point t
require-final-newline t
visible-bell t
load-prefer-newer t
ediff-window-setup-function 'ediff-setup-windows-plain
custom-file (expand-file-name "~/.emacs.d/custom.el"))
(unless backup-directory-alist
(setq backup-directory-alist `(("." . ,(concat user-emacs-directory
"backups")))))

(use-package tempel
:bind (("M-+" . tempel-complete)
("M-*" . tempel-insert)
:map tempel-map
("M-]" . tempel-next)
("M-[" . tempel-previous))
:init
;; Setup completion at point
(defun tempel-setup-capf ()
;; Add the Tempel Capf to `completion-at-point-functions'.
;; `tempel-expand' only triggers on exact matches. Alternatively use
;; `tempel-complete' if you want to see all matches, but then you
;; should also configure `tempel-trigger-prefix', such that Tempel
;; does not trigger too often when you don't expect it. NOTE: We add
;; `tempel-expand' *before* the main programming mode Capf, such
;; that it will be tried first.
(setq-local completion-at-point-functions
(cons #'tempel-expand
completion-at-point-functions)))
(add-hook 'prog-mode-hook 'tempel-setup-capf)
(add-hook 'text-mode-hook 'tempel-setup-capf)
;; Optionally make the Tempel templates available to Abbrev,
;; either locally or globally. `expand-abbrev' is bound to C-x '.
;; (add-hook 'prog-mode-hook #'tempel-abbrev-mode)
;; (global-tempel-abbrev-mode)
)

(defun ediff-copy-both-to-C ()
"combine both buffers into the result buffer in order"
(interactive)
(ediff-copy-diff ediff-current-difference nil 'C nil
(concat
(ediff-get-region-contents ediff-current-difference 'A ediff-control-buffer)
(ediff-get-region-contents ediff-current-difference 'B ediff-control-buffer))))
(defun add-d-to-ediff-mode-map () (define-key ediff-mode-map "d" 'ediff-copy-both-to-C))
(add-hook 'ediff-keymap-setup-hook 'add-d-to-ediff-mode-map)
